In this CPU comparison, we compare the Intel Core2 Duo E6700 and the Intel Celeron N2940 and use benchmarks to check which processor is faster.

We compare the Intel Core2 Duo E6700 2 core processor released in Q3/2006 with the Intel Celeron N2940 which has 4 CPU cores and was introduced in Q2/2014.

CPU Cores and Base Frequency

The Intel Core2 Duo E6700 is a 2 core processor with a clock frequency of 2.66 GHz. The processor can compute 2 threads at the same time. The Intel Celeron N2940 clocks with 1.83 GHz (2.25 GHz), has 4 CPU cores and can calculate 4 threads in parallel.

Memory & PCIe

Up to 16 GB of memory in a maximum of 2 memory channels is supported by the Intel Core2 Duo E6700, while the Intel Celeron N2940 supports a maximum of 8 GB of memory with a maximum memory bandwidth of 21.3 GB/s enabled.

Thermal Management

The Intel Core2 Duo E6700 has a TDP of 65 W. The TDP of the Intel Celeron N2940 is 7.5 W. System integrators use the TDP of the processor as a guide when dimensioning the cooling solution.

Technical details

The Intel Core2 Duo E6700 has 4.00 MB cache and is manufactured in 65 nm. The cache of Intel Celeron N2940 is at 2.00 MB. The processor is manufactured in 22 nm.
